FSMB Centennial Advisory Panel
The Federation applauds the excellent work of its Centennial Advisory Panel. Over the course of nearly two years, the panel developed recommendations for centennial events and assisted staff in planning. Among the panel’s recommendations were those encouraging FSMB to develop a centennial section for its website, drafting a formal written history of the organization (scheduled for release later this year), including appropriate historical/centennial content in the Journal of Medical Regulation during 2012, and convening a national symposium in Washington DC.

FSMB Recognizes the Iowa Board of Medicine
The Iowa Board of Medicine celebrated its 125th anniversary recently with a ceremony marking the occasion. The Iowa board also holds the distinct of being one of the Federation’s original charter member boards in 1913. Only twenty-one (21) boards hold this distinction. Tammy McGee, MBA, represented the FSMB Board of Directors and presented a framed proclamation to the Iowa board paying tribute to their contributions to the medical regulatory community.
